Remote development is changing how plugins should be built for JetBrains IDEs. The IDE is no longer a single local process: users interact with a frontend client, while the backend can run on another machine, in Docker, or in the cloud. This model is becoming increasingly important because it supports powerful remote environments, better security, and more flexible development workflows. In the case of JetBrains IDEs running backend and frontend processes simultaneously, we say they are operating in split mode.
